Why Live in North Queen Anne

North Queen Anne, part of Seattle's Queen Anne enclave, is renowned for its scenic views of the Space Needle, Puget Sound, Elliot Bay, and Mount Rainier, often featured in classic films and TV shows like “Frasier.” This suburban neighborhood offers a blend of nature and urban convenience, with Highway 99 providing quick access to downtown Seattle in 10 minutes and the airport in 20 minutes. Residents benefit from a highly walkable area with access to light rail and daily buses. The neighborhood features tree-lined streets with Queen Anne mansions, Tudors, and Craftsman homes, some offering mountain and Lake Union views. Real estate is highly sought after, with homes selling faster than the national average. The local school system is top-rated, with students attending Coe Elementary School, McClure Middle School, and Cleveland High School STEM.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y moderate temperatures for most of the year, with scenic parks like Kerry Park and Soundview Terrace offering stunning vistas. The Bainbridge Ferry provides a relaxing journey to Bainbridge Island, while Queen Anne’s Loop connects locals through miles of staircases. Queen Anne Avenue North features walkable shops, dining options, and amenities, including Betty’s bistro-style restaurant, Café Ladro, and The Little Store. The local farmers market runs from October to June, and the neighborhood celebrates Queen Anne’s Days annually. North Queen Anne is safer than the national average, making it a practical choice for urban professionals seeking a quieter lifestyle.
